import traverse from "../lib"; import { parse } from "@babel/parser"; describe("path/ancestry", function () { describe("isAncestor", function () { const ast = parse("var a = 1; 'a';"); it("returns true if ancestor", function () { const paths = []; traverse(ast, { "Program|NumericLiteral"(path) { paths.push(path); }, }); const [programPath, numberPath] = paths; expect(programPath.isAncestor(numberPath)).toBeTruthy(); }); it("returns false if not ancestor", function () { const paths = []; traverse(ast, { "Program|NumericLiteral|StringLiteral"(path) { paths.push(path); }, }); const [, numberPath, stringPath] = paths; expect(stringPath.isAncestor(numberPath)).toBeFalsy(); }); }); describe("isDescendant", function () { const ast = parse("var a = 1; 'a';"); it("returns true if descendant", function () { const paths = []; traverse(ast, { "Program|NumericLiteral"(path) { paths.push(path); }, }); const [programPath, numberPath] = paths; expect(numberPath.isDescendant(programPath)).toBeTruthy(); }); it("returns false if not descendant", function () { const paths = []; traverse(ast, { "Program|NumericLiteral|StringLiteral"(path) { paths.push(path); }, }); const [, numberPath, stringPath] = paths; expect(numberPath.isDescendant(stringPath)).toBeFalsy(); }); }); describe("getStatementParent", function () { const ast = parse("var a = 1;"); it("should throw", function () { expect(function () { traverse(ast, { Program(path) { path.getStatementParent(); }, }); }).toThrow(/File\/Program node/); }); }); });
